NUS Scotland Black Students' campaign is launching #ReclaimBlackStories an exhibition that you can host in your students' association or share online to share the reality of Black history and what it's like to live in Scotland at the moment - as told by Black students. 

More about the exhibition 

#ReclaimBlackStories aims to reclaim the experience of Black People historically, and in the present. Stories that have been undervalued and mythicised both academically and popular culture; those that have too long been told through Eurocentric and imperialists narratives. As a photo-biographic exhibit, BlackStories gives young black people a platform to reclaim the narrative, retell the story according to their experiences and those of their families.
